Donald Smith & CO. Inc. lessened its stake in SiriusPoint Ltd. (NYSE:SPNT – Free Report) by 11.9% in the second quarter, according to its most recent 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The institutional investor owned 6,852,137 shares of the company’s stock after selling 923,472 shares during the quarter. SiriusPoint accounts for 3.3% of Donald Smith & CO. Inc.’s investment portfolio, making the stock its 10th largest position. Donald Smith & CO. Inc. owned approximately 5.87% of SiriusPoint worth $139,715,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ission.

SiriusPoint Profile
SiriusPoint Ltd. provides multi-line insurance and reinsurance products and services worldwide. The company operates through two segments, Reinsurance, and Insurance & Services. The Reinsurance segment provides aviation and space, accident and health, casualty, credit, marine and energy, property to insurance and reinsurance companies, government entities, and other risk bearing vehicles.
